What is parental responsibility in Guatemala?

Parental responsibility in Guatemala refers to the set of rights and obligations that parents have over their children, including their care, protection, education, health and comprehensive development.

What are the fundamental rights recognized in Guatemala?

In Guatemala, the fundamental rights recognized are: the right to life, equality, non-discrimination, personal freedom and security, freedom of thought, conscience and religion, freedom of expression, privacy and privacy, property, work, health, education, among others.
